Mozzarella Cheese Tree
Equipment
Ingredients
- 1 can grand biscuits
- 12 pieces mozzarella cheese sticks
- 2 tbsp butter melted
- 1 tbsp Minced Garlic
- 1½ tsp parsley
Instructions
- Cut biscuits in ¼ pieces
- Cut Mozzarella cheese sticks cut into 3 sections
- Flatten biscuit and wrap each piece of cheese
- Arrange dough balls in the shape of a tree on sheet pan
- Mix in melted butter, minced garlic, and parsley and baste over the top of the Stuffed biscuit dough balls
- Bake 375 for 15 mins until done – should be nice and golden when done
- Once you take out of the oven add little springs of Rosemary as a garnish all throughout the tree.
- Also shaking on some grated parmesan cheese to the top of the tree will give it a “snowy” appearance.
- Serve with your favorite dipping sauce
